
Awele Elumelu named new chair of Transcorp Hotels board
Dr Awele Elumelu has been appointed as the new Chair of Transcorp Hotels Plc, effective January 1, 2026. She succeeds Emmanuel Nnorom, who will retire from the position on the same date. Awele Elumelu brings a wealth of experience in healthcare, insurance, and philanthropy to the role. Her leadership is expected to drive innovation and strengthen the company’s commitment to excellence in hospitality.

- Awele Elumelu will become Chair of Transcorp Hotels Plc starting January 1, 2026, following the retirement of Emmanuel Nnorom.
- She currently leads Avon Healthcare Limited, Avon Medical Practice, and Heirs Insurance Brokers, and is a founding Director of Heirs Holdings Limited.
- Elumelu is also a Trustee and Co-Founder of the Tony Elumelu Foundation, which supports young African entrepreneurs.
- Her background includes medical training, executive education from top global institutions, and a focus on social impact and gender inclusion.
- Analysts expect her appointment to boost Transcorp Hotels’ innovation, operational efficiency, and expansion in Nigeria and beyond.
